In numericalanalysis, the Runge-Kutta methods are an important family of implicitand explicit iterative methods for the approximation of solutions ofordinary differential equations. These techniques were developed around1900 by the German mathematicians C. Runge and M.W. Kutta.See thearticle on numerical ordinary differential equations for more backgroundand other methods.
